Job Details
This role is in support of Cencora's global pharma consulting services marketed through our PharmaLex business. The purpose of this role is to own and lead the DevOps function, helping teams ship software faster and more safely by building and improving Azure infrastructure and CI/CD pipelines, driving automation and a shift-left culture, and mentoring engineers.
Responsibilities:
- Define and drive the DevOps Vision and using Agile best practices
- Set direction, standards, and best practices for the team
- Lead the design of scalable, secure, and reliable infrastructure and delivery pipelines
- Establish and maintain CI/CD pipelines for multiple applications and services
- Align DevOps initiatives with engineering, product, and business goals
- Ensure high-quality engineering is demonstrated across the team
- Design, deploy and maintain cloud infrastructure (Azure)
- Mentor engineers and promote knowledge sharing
- Facilitate clear communication between the different departments
- Advocate DevOps culture across the teams looking to shift-left wherever possible
Requirements:
- 6+ years in DevOps/Cloud/Platform Engineering roles
- 2+ years in a technical leadership or team lead capacity
- Strong hands-on experience with Microsoft Azure (VMs/networking/Storage, AKS, App Services, Keyvault)
- Deep experience with Kubernetes in production environments
- Strong infrastructure as code experience, mainly Terraform/Helm
- Strong CI/CD experience, ideally with Azure DevOps
- Candidates must be based in Poland (ideally located near Lublin) or the United Kingdom
- Functional development/coding ability with at least one language - Golang/Python/PowerShell/bash
- Strong understanding of networking, security, and cloud architecture
- Experience working in cross-functional engineering teams
- Familiar with observability platforms
- Cloudflare/Edge/WAF knowledge - will be a plus
- LLM experience - will be a plus
- Minimum of 5 GCSEs at grades A–C (9–4), including Maths and English, or equivalent high school diploma
- Works under broad direction and often self-initiates tasks
- Makes decisions impacting results and deadlines
- Demonstrates leadership in operational management and encourages learning and growth
- Understands and evaluates the organizational impact of new technologies and digital services
